TMNT: Shredder’s Revenge: A Blast From The Past
Teenage Mutant Ninja Turtles: Shredder's Revenge is a side-scrolling beat 'em up game heavily inspired by the 80's Turtles animated …
Teenage Mutant Ninja Turtles: Shredder's Revenge is a side-scrolling beat 'em up game heavily inspired by the 80's Turtles animated …